
Senior Account Manager
DEPT®
full-time
Posted on:
Location Type: Hybrid
Location: London • United Kingdom
Visit company websiteExplore more
Job Level
Tech Stack
About the role
- Develop annual strategies, identifying priorities for the year
- Oversee, project manage and work with teams to develop brilliant digital content (creative, production)
- Manage deliverables from across the business (content, technology, media, data)
- Ensure delivery of work is to the highest possible standard
- Ensure constant innovation across all deliverables
- Contribute to our creative process by sharing your ideas and experiences
- Manage budgets for campaigns and always-on activity
- Manage client budgeting
- Manage relationships with platforms and partners
- Present work internally and externally
- Complete work to deadline and often under pressure
Requirements
- Extensive experience in roles involving account management and strategic planning within digital / social platforms
- Experience developing, managing & overseeing complex creative campaigns
- Experience working on a global brand
- Confident with both brand and conversion/direct-response campaigns
- Experience leading, motivating and coaching team members
- Strong client relationship management skills
- Brilliant written and verbal English communication skills
- Advanced problem-solving skills
- Excellent organisational / time management skills and high attention to detail
- Excellent presentation skills
- Strong creative skills
- Ability to build and maintain strong relationships with clients
- Ability to react quickly within a fast-paced environment
- Ability to remain focused under pressure and work under tight deadlines
- Proficient in working with data
Benefits
- A flexible, hybrid working policy
- The choice of medical healthcare providers (Bupa or Medicash)
- 25 days holiday plus bank holidays and your birthday off each year
- Company pension scheme
- EAP scheme
- Ride to work scheme
- Enhanced family friendly policies
- Buddy Program: You will be paired with a ‘Buddy’ to help you through your first weeks’ at DEPT®.
- A reputation for doing good. DEPT® has been a Certified B Corp® since 2021 and named ‘Agency of the Year’ at both The Lovies and The Webby Awards.
- Awesome clients. Whether big or small, local or global — at DEPT® you’ll get the opportunity to work with clients of all sizes and across all industries. And we celebrate all of our successes together!
- The opportunity for possibility. We want to enable you to do what you do best and help you develop your skills further with training, development and certifications.
- Global annual DEPT® Cares Month in which employees come together and donate their skills to support local charities.
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
account managementstrategic planningcreative campaignsbudget managementdata analysis
Soft Skills
client relationship managementwritten communicationverbal communicationproblem-solvingorganizational skillstime managementattention to detailpresentation skillscreative skillsability to work under pressure